On 04/11/2013 06:24 AM, Scott Lair wrote:
Hello,
Is it possible to list files in an increment? I see a week ago that an
increment size was several gigs and want to find out what files are in
there.
rdiff-backup -v5 --list-at-time time /rdiff_dir
It will list the files present but not their sizes. It also works on sub
directories of the root rdiff directory.
FYI --list-increment-sizes will also work on sub directories, which can
be a useful way of narrowing down where large files are.
